Kiss and Fly launches at Vilnius Airport

Vilnius Airport is starting a barrier-free Kiss and Fly system for its main terminal road. The new system will allow drivers to stop for free for 10 minutes in a controlled area on the road next to the terminal entrance. A multifunctional parking lot has been opened at Vilnius Airport

A modern multifunctional parking lot has been launched in Vilnius Airport, the largest airport in the country.
